One of the most important aspects of swimming pool maintenance is water chemistry. Proper water balance is essential for the health of swimmers and the longevity of the pool itself. Regularly testing the water for pH, chlorine levels, alkalinity, and calcium hardness can help prevent issues such as algae growth, cloudy water, and corrosion of pool equipment.

 

Cleaning the pool regularly is also crucial for maintaining water quality and preventing the buildup of debris and contaminants. Skimming the surface of the water, vacuuming the pool floor, and brushing the walls and tile can help keep the pool clean and free of algae, bacteria, and other unwanted substances.

 

In addition to water chemistry and cleaning, homeowners should also pay attention to the condition of their pool equipment. Regularly inspecting and servicing pumps, filters, heaters, and other components can help identify and address issues before they become major problems. It's also important to keep the pool's circulation system running efficiently to ensure proper water flow and filtration.
